CLACKAMAS ROTARY FOUNDATION ANNOUNCES BENEFICIARIES OF 2022 GOLF TOURNAMENT
The Clackamas Rotary Foundation has selected four local nonprofits and the Clackamas Community College Scholarship Fund as recipients of proceeds that will be raised in their 30th annual golf tournament. The tournament will take place on Friday, June 24th, 2022 at Stone Creek Golf Club in Oregon City.
Event organizer and member of the Rotary Club of Clackamas, Dennis Curtis, said the club is especially pleased to be supporting these organizations. “These four nonprofits are all new to us, are all local and all serve children in our county. The Rotary Club of Clackamas and our affiliate, The Clackamas Rotary Foundation, have been supporting the Clackamas Community College scholarship program for more than 25 years.”
Foundation president, Thomas Joseph, added, “ We are celebrating the 30th year of our annual golf tournament. With the exception of 2020, the tournament has grown each year and we are proud to contribute these funds to organizations that serve and strengthen Clackamas County.”
The five recipients are:
The Angels in the Outfield is an all-volunteer organization seeking to brighten the lives of children who have been impacted by crime or child abuse.
Bloomin’ Boutique provides new clothing, shoes, bedding and personal care items to underprivileged children, empowering them to become confident, constructive members of their communities.
Greater Clackamas YoungLives is a ministry designed to empower and equip teen moms. They offer hope to young mothers and their children by providing acceptance and unconditional love while creating a space to share life with other teen mothers.
The Children’s Course is home to The First Tee-Greater Portland, which provides young people with character-building and life-skills lessons using golf as the platform.
Clackamas Community College Scholarship Program Clackamas Rotary has been supporting education at CCC for over 25 years, providing funds for students who have limited means but unlimited dreams.
The Clackamas Rotary Foundation (CRF) was founded in 1986 for the purpose of creating and managing funds to support the charitable work of the Rotary Club of Clackamas. CRF is an independent 501c3 charitable organization that maintains a close relationship with the Rotary Club of Clackamas.
